Youth Program Leader

2 weeks ago


Metro Vancouver Regional District, Canada Engkidz Full time

Looking for an exciting and rewarding part-time job? EngKidz is seeking energetic Youth Program Leaders in Lower Mainland This part-time position is ideal for students and recent graduates who are looking to develop communication and leadership skills.

**What you will do**:

- Lead in-person STEM programs at Recreation Centers in a fun and engaging way
- Help kids build their hands-on projects and troubleshoot issues
- Exercise your creativity and develop new workshops, activities, and classes
- Gain experience in marketing, customer engagement, and other activities as needed
**Why work with us?**
- Flexible hours (8 to 24 hours per week) depending on availability
- We provide training, guidance, and an opportunity to be creative
- You will develop leadership and communication skills while having fun every day
- An opportunity to work hands-on and make science books come to life
**Who you are**:

- Either a Canadian Citizen, PR, or a Protected Person
- Class 5 or 7 driver's license and able to drive to various locations around Lower Mainland
- Interested in working with children between 6-13 years of age. Prior teaching or coaching experience is an asset
- Enrollment in a science/engineering program is an asset
- Background check and First-Aid certification will be required prior to start
**Company description**

**Job Type**: Part-time
Part-time hours: 8-24 per week

**Salary**: $18.00-$22.00 per hour
